WebMar 20, 2024 · key things to remember when delivering farm flowers: Harvest flowers such as lilies and tulips at a very tight stage. You will be surprised how much they color up and want to open during a trip in the delivery van, even with the air conditioning blasting. You don’t want to show up at the florist shop with blown out flowers.

Webflowers are best cut in the bud stage and opened after storage, transport or distribution. This technique has many advantages, including reduced growing time for single-harvest crops, increased product packing density, simplified temperature management, reduced susceptibility to mechanical damage and reduced desiccation. WebJan 10, 2024 · Apply fresh water to the plant five to six hours before you start digging it out of the soil. Semi-dry soil is perfect for shipping plants. When digging, dig a few inches away from the main stem of the plant so you don’t damage the roots.
